Title :
A distributed architecture for discovery and access in the internet of things
Author :
Tanganelli, G. ; Mingozzi, E. ; Vallati, C. ; Cicconetti, Claudio
Author_Institution :
Dipt. di Ing. dell´Inf., Univ. of Pisa, Pisa, Italy
Abstract :
A complete, though small-scale, end-to-end architecture for the Internet of Things (IoT) is demonstrated by means of a test-bed including: smart objects (both clients and servers) with limited capabilities and proxy devices which allow the latter to connect to a core network, where a peer-to-peer (P2P) overlay is set up and maintained for automatic discovery of resources and highly scalable access. The Constrained Application Protocol (CoAP) is used by smart objects to enable Machine-to-Machine (M2M) communications following a resource-oriented approach. Business logic and human interactions with the smart objects for aggregation and visualization, respectively, are also demonstrated, including Android mobile applications.
Keywords :
Internet of Things; peer-to-peer computing; protocols; smart phones; software architecture; Android mobile applications; CoAP; Internet of Things; IoT access; IoT discovery; M2M communications; P2P overlay; aggregation; automatic resources discovery; business logic; clients; constrained application protocol; core network; distributed architecture; human interactions; machine-to-machine communications; peer-to-peer overlay; proxy devices; resource-oriented approach; servers; small-scale end-to-end architecture; smart objects; visualization; IEEE 802.15 Standards; Internet of Things; Monitoring; Peer-to-peer computing; Protocols; Servers; Switches;
Conference_Titel :
Computer Communications Workshops (INFOCOM WKSHPS), 2013 IEEE Conference on
Conference_Location :
Turin
Print_ISBN :
978-1-4799-0055-8
DOI :
10.1109/INFCOMW.2013.6970729